Abstract
The utility model discloses a kind of barricade, its drip irrigation device is to include wall group, the wall group include contact with sluice the first wall, positioned at the first wall away from sluice the second wall, second wall is set to trapezoidal, the big end of second wall is connected by cement soil matrix with ground, second wall is provided with reinforced concrete bottom plate close to the side of cement soil matrix, the reinforced concrete bottom plate is provided with reinforcing portion towards the side of sluice, and the reinforcing portion includes the tissue layer fitted with ground, the rock layers being covered in tissue layer.It is arranged such, connected between second wall and ground by cement soil matrix, improve the bonding strength between the second wall and ground, reinforced concrete bottom plate then improves the bonding strength between the second wall and cement soil matrix, reinforcing portion reduces the possibility for the surface smoothness reduction that extraneous such as current flowing factor is caused, and improves the intensity and soundness of whole second wall.

Embodiment
The utility model is described in further detail below in conjunction with accompanying drawing.
Embodiment 1:A kind of barricade, as shown in figure 1, including wall group 1, wall group 1 includes the first wall close to sluice
11 and the second wall 12 away from sluice.
As shown in Fig. 2 the second wall 12 is set to vertical plane towards sluice side, it is set to tilt away from sluice side
Face, it is right-angled trapezium to make whole second wall 12.The big end of right-angled trapezium is contacted with ground.
As shown in Fig. 2 connected between the bottom and ground of the second wall 12 by reinforced concrete bottom plate 3, reinforced concrete bottom plate 3
Area is more than the bottom area of the second wall 12.
As shown in Fig. 2 reinforced concrete bottom plate 3 is additionally provided with reinforcing portion 4, reinforcing portion close to the side of the vertical plane of the second wall 12
4 thickness and the thickness of reinforced concrete bottom plate 3 are similar, reinforcing portion 4 from close to the side of ground, set gradually for:Tissue layer 41, rock layers
42.Wherein, the material of tissue layer 41 is used without spinning filament geotextiles;Rock layers 42 include blotter 421 and cemented rock 422,
Wherein, blotter 421 and tissue layer 41 are inconsistent, and cemented rock 422 is arranged on one that blotter 421 deviates from tissue layer 41
Side.The thickness of blotter 421 uses 100mm, and the thickness of cemented rock 422 uses 400mm.
As shown in Fig. 2 trapezoidal cement soil matrix 2 is additionally provided with below reinforced concrete bottom plate 3 and reinforcing portion 4, cement soil matrix 2
Big end is contradicted with reinforced concrete bottom plate 3, and cement soil matrix 2 is embedded in ground.
As shown in Fig. 2 being connected between the second wall 12 and reinforced concrete bottom plate 3 using reinforcement 8, reinforcement 8 is handed over two-by-two
Fork, one end is embedded in the second wall 12, other end embedment reinforced concrete bottom plate 3.
As shown in Fig. 2 the wall 12 of cement soil matrix 2 and second is made of plain concrete, wall includes plain concrete main body 7, in element
Drainpipe 5 is equipped with concrete main body 7.Vertical height of the drainpipe 5 close to the side of the inclined plane of the second wall 12 is higher than draining
The vertical height of the other end of pipe 5.In drainpipe 5 sand lump 6 is also covered with towards one end of the inclined plane of the second wall 12.Drainpipe
5 a diameter of 80mm, its material selection PVC.
